Finding a Treadmill For Sale

A treadmill is a great option for those looking to work out without having to go to an exercise facility or endure the harsh weather. However, finding the best treadmill for your needs requires balancing price and features.

For instance, you might be tempted to go for a model with a stronger motor and longer running deck, but it might cost you too high.

Safety

Treadmills have become a common piece of equipment in gyms as well as in home fitness centers. Although they are a simple and efficient way to improve your fitness and lose weight, they also carry some dangers to safety when not utilized in a proper manner. According to the Consumer Product Safety Commission, treadmills for sale uk are responsible for the injury of 20,000 people each year and three deaths.

The safety concerns for treadmills include the possibility of friction burns and injuries to children who play on or near the machine. When buying a treadmill for sale, it's important to choose a treadmill with a safety stop switch and follow the manufacturer's instructions for use.

Another major consideration is ensuring that the treadmill is located in a secure location in the home. It should be stored in a room that has a locked door to limit access by pets or children. A treadmill should never be left unattended, as it may be able to move abruptly. Consider whether the treadmill should be left out in the open or covered.

If a treadmill is located in an open area it is best to cover it with a sturdy curtain or put it against the wall. This will stop children and pets from getting too close to the belt. A covered treadmill protects it from dust, dirt, and debris which can damage the motor.

Most people are concerned about treadmill safety when they fall off. This can be prevented by keeping your eyes on the task at hand, and not looking at the console on the treadmill. This can lead to problems with balance and even injury, especially for beginners.

When you're using a treadmill it's important to wear the right shoes. Shoes designed for indoor use will provide better support and comfort and reduce the risk of blisters and sore feet. It is not recommended to run or walk barefoot since this can result in poor balance and stress to joints and calves.

The Right to Rent

Treadmills are constructed from durable materials and designs to take the pounding that they take, but even the most durable treadmills aren't immune to breaking down. These problems are typically caused by wear and tear or mechanical issues like motor failure. If this happens, it can be expensive to have the treadmill repaired, especially when the warranty has expired.

If you are purchasing a new or used treadmill for sale, be sure to verify the warranty of the manufacturer prior to making an purchase. Based on your warranty, you may need to pay for an extended warranty or extra coverage. This is particularly relevant if the treadmill has already been used for several years.

When looking at a treadmill home on sale, make sure you examine the frame and parts/electronics warranties. Electronics and parts are the most susceptible to fail, so you will want a good warranty for these areas. A minimum of one year is acceptable, however special treadmills typically offer 5 or 10 year warranties for their electronic components and parts. Department store brands, on the other hand typically only offer one or two year warranties for their parts.

Certain treadmills home gym have warranties that are not valid when they are stored in an area where the temperature is not controlled, for example, garages or outdoor spaces. These kinds of spaces are likely to see temperatures that fluctuate throughout the year, which could cause the equipment to stop functioning properly.

If you're considering buying a treadmill available for sale, be sure you read the warranty in detail. Find out if you will be required to bring the treadmill to a repair facility to have it repaired or if they'll perform a home visit. Also, inquire about the hourly rates they charge and how long they expect to spend working on the treadmill. This will help you decide whether or not a repair is suitable for your situation. Some treadmills can be repaired for a much lower fee than others, which is why maintaining your treadmill regularly is a crucial step to taking.
